Spot
5555 Golden Gate Pkwy 34116-7512 Naples Florida USA
- Profile: Spot is a Eating and drinking places company located at Naples, Florida USA, address is 5555 Golden Gate Pkwy, Naples 34116-7512 FL, postcode is 34116-7512, you can contact Spot by phone 2393532250